#5e5612 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5e5612 is composed of 36.9% red, 33.7% green and 7.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 8.5% magenta, 80.9% yellow and 63.1% black. It has a hue angle of 53.7 degrees, a saturation of 67.9% and a lightness of 22%. #5e5612 color hex could be obtained by blending #bcac24 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666600.

Shades and Tints of #5e5612
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0b02 is the darkest color, while #fefefa is the lightest one.
